    I want to embed my calendar on a page using the list view shortcode, but I simply want a list of the events. I don’t want the featured image, author, comments and other metadata to come a long with it. How might I modify the shortcode to pull out the unwanted pieces of data?

    You can customize our template files using one of the methods described in our themer’s guide > https://theeventscalendar.com/knowledgebase/themers-guide/

    In your case, the list.php template file is located at /wp-content/plugins/the-events-calendar/src/views/list.php
